PH has 3,246 confirmed cases of Covid-19: DOH

CAGAYAN de Oro City–The Department of Health (DOH) has recorded 3,246 confirmed cases of Coronavirus disease 2019 (Covid-19) as of 4 p.m. on April 5.

The DOH said 1,560 were tested negative of the virus while 1,166 cases are pending test results.

Of the 3,246 confirmed cases, the heath department said 64 patients have recovered while 152 died.

Earlier, President Rodrigo Duterte is planning to extend a two-week extension of the the enhanced community quarantine (ECQ), according to a report made by the government-run Philippine News Agency (PNA).

In Cagayan de Oro City, some village residents grumbled over the slow response of their village officials and local officials in releasing food packs and relief goods.

Based on online sources, there are 1,216,422 confirmed cases worldwide of which 65,711 died while 252,478 have recovered.

United States had 311,658 confirmed cases of which 14,967 have recovered while 8,492 died.

Spain had 130,759 confirmed cases and 12,418 were confirmed dead while 38,080 had recovered.

In Italy, 15,362 died of covid and 20,996 recovered from the virus. Italy had 124,632 confirmed cases.

Coronavirus disease is an infectious disease caused by a new virus.

The disease causes respiratory illness (like the flu) with symptoms such as a cough, fever, and in more severe cases, difficulty breathing. You can protect yourself by washing your hands frequently, avoiding touching your face, and avoiding close contact (1 meter or 3 feet) with people who are unwell.

There’s currently no vaccine to prevent coronavirus, but you can protect yourself and help prevent the spread of the virus to others if you:

1. Wash your hands regularly for 20 seconds, with soap and water or alcohol-based hand rub
2. Cover your nose and mouth with a disposable tissue or flexed elbow when you cough or sneeze
3. Avoid close contact (1 meter or 3 feet) with people who are unwell
4. Stay home and self-isolate from others in the household if you feel unwell
5. Don't touch your eyes, nose, or mouth if your hands are not clean
